How debt consolidation saves money

Debt consolidation replaces multiple loans - each with its own rate, EMI date, and lender - with a single loan at a lower blended rate. If you are servicing three loans at 16-24% and consolidate at 13%, the saving lands in your bank account every single month.

The savings come from two places: a lower rate (lenders price one larger, cleaner loan better than several small ones) and simpler cash flow (one EMI date, one lender relationship, no juggling).

What is a debt consolidation calculator?

This calculator compares your current EMI outflow against a single consolidated loan at a new rate over the same tenure. The difference is your monthly saving; multiplied across the tenure, it shows the total interest you avoid paying.

When consolidation makes sense

Rate gap of 3%+

If the new rate beats your blended current rate by 3 percentage points or more, savings usually outweigh processing costs comfortably.

Multiple small expensive loans

Several NBFC or fintech loans at 18-24% are the classic consolidation candidates - one bank loan at 12-14% transforms the cost.

Cash flow strain

Even at a similar rate, stretching the tenure through consolidation lowers the monthly outflow when cash is tight.

Watch prepayment charges

Check foreclosure charges on existing loans (typically 2-4% for fixed-rate business loans) and net them against the savings.
